When a gunshot echoed through Debsirin Nonthaburi School on the outskirts of Bangkok, 14-year-old student Khim and her classmates rushed to lean over a balcony, initially unsure whether the loud noise was a firecracker or something far more dangerous. Within moments, reality set in as teachers ordered immediate lockdowns, plunging the campus into fear and forcing students to hide inside classrooms while authorities responded to the active security threat.
The incident on Friday morning highlights the sudden terror experienced by students and parents during school violence incidents, prompting urgent questions regarding campus security measures and emergency response protocols in suburban educational facilities. As law enforcement secured the perimeter and parents rushed to the area, communication lines flooded with frantic text messages and muted phone calls as children hid beneath desks and inside locked rooms.
According to local reports and official updates from responding agencies, emergency services deployed personnel to the school grounds shortly after the initial reports of gunfire. Security forces worked to sweep the buildings, evacuate students safely, and establish a secure zone around the campus while worried family members gathered outside the gates waiting for news.
Emergency Lockdown and Student Response at Debsirin Nonthaburi School
As the gravity of the situation became apparent, teachers at Debsirin Nonthaburi School executed emergency lockdown procedures, turning off lights, pulling down blinds, and instructing students to remain silent. For many teenagers inside the building, the immediate reaction involved quick thinking and desperate attempts to contact family members while keeping out of sight.
Students described scrambling away from hallways and gathering in interior corners of classrooms. The sound of sirens soon filled the air outside as police units and medical responders arrived at the campus. Authorities directed parents to designated reunification areas away from the active police response zone to ensure emergency vehicles had clear access to the school.
Community Impact and Safety Concerns
The shooting incident has drawn immediate concern from local officials, educators, and parent networks across Nonthaburi and the wider Bangkok metropolitan region. Community leaders have called for a comprehensive review of campus safety measures, metal detector usage, and visitor access controls to prevent weapons from entering educational environments.
Educational authorities emphasized that counseling services and psychological support teams would be made available to students, teachers, and families affected by the trauma of the event. Local administrative bodies pledged to work closely with law enforcement agencies to investigate how the firearm was brought onto school grounds and to determine what additional preventative protocols can be implemented across secondary schools in the region.
As investigations continue, school administrators and government officials are expected to release further findings regarding the security breach and any subsequent policy changes aimed at safeguarding students during school hours.
